The Siemens 3RT1045-3AD20 is a SIRIUS S3 power contactor rated for motor switching at 45 kW on a 500 V AC-3 supply. AC-3 duty at 1,000 operating cycles per hour; mechanical life of 10,000,000 operations typical.
The headline motor rating is 45 kW at 500 V AC-3 (50 Hz). At 690 V AC-3 the rating drops to 21.1 kW — this is the standard derating for higher voltage motor switching. If your line runs at 400 V, the contactor is rated for 3 A in AC-1 resistive duty, but the motor (AC-3) rating at 400 V is not explicitly stated in the available data; the 500 V figure is the one to use for sizing at that voltage. The coil operates at 50/60 Hz with a voltage tolerance of 0.8 to 1.1 times rated value at 50 Hz, and 0.85 to 1.1 at 60 Hz. The rated control supply voltage is 42 V at 50/60 Hz — a common control voltage in some industrial installations, but verify your panel's control transformer output before specifying. Auxiliary contact ratings: 10 A at 24 V, 6 A at 230 V, 3 A at 400 V, and 0.3 A at 220 V DC. The DC switching capability is limited — at 220 V DC only 0.3 A, so inductive DC loads like brake coils or DC valve solenoids need careful checking against the make/break curve.
Wiring and terminal capacity
Screw-type terminals on main circuit accept solid 2x (0.25 to 2.5 mm²), stranded 2x (10 to 50 mm²), and solid/stranded 2x (2.5 to 16 mm²). The contactor is 70 mm wide, 146 mm high, and 139 mm deep.
